local color

1. The unique character of a particular place or geographic area, as created by its customs, accent, style of dress, etc. You have to visit Philadelphia's Italian Market to get a true taste of the local color. The author has been celebrated for capturing the local color of the American South.
2. In art, the color of an object in normal light with no modifications or effects. Is this the local color of the teacups, or did you paint them under studio lights?
